Los Angeles protesters hold eviction parties

10:04 pm on 28 November 2011

Occupy Wall Street protesters camped outside City Hall in Los Angeles are holding eviction parties as the deadline for them to leave passes.

City officals had given the group until midnight local time on Sunday to depart. The protesters are part of a world-wide movement against corporate greed.

Police have been handing out leaflets informing occupants of the nearly 500 tents that the clock was ticking, the BBC reports.

The police chief says his officers will seek to encourage people to leave peacefully, but suspects some arrests are likely.

As the deadline approached, some of those camped outside attended sessions on resistance tactics, including how to stay safe should police begin firing rubber bullets or use pepper spray.
